LAHORE (Dunya News) – Government pocketed Rs 216 billion through general sales tax (GST) in first six months of Fiscal Year (FY) 2015-16 amid falling crude prices, Dunya News reported Monday.

Crude oil prices have fallen 70 percent in the last one and a half years.

Experts have said that the locals are not benefitting off the lessened price of imported fuel as the government has increased GST after lowering prices. Statistics show that the government earned Rs 127 billion in July-December period at local level while Rs 89 percent on import level.

Experts have denounced the government for making oil products a source of earning and cut taxes to relieve the people.

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) should nab tax evaders to fill up national treasury, experts added.
